Here is your chance to try out Greener Clean Designs. Greener Clean Designs is a small business focused on eco-friendly, cruelty-free, and zero waste products for your home.

Allison — Greener Clean Designs founder — is a certified master herbalist educated on plant benefits. Allison uses her education to produce items that will keep your family safe — while also making sure those tough messes will get clean.

Not only are the items tough on messes, safe for your family, but they are also ethically sourced and okay for the environment. From baking soda to glycerin, you can count on all the ingredients to being safe for animals and children.

Items are shipped in recycled mailers and cardboard — while also using recyclable packing supplies. Your first-time items are sent in glass jars so that you can reuse them over and over. When you order refills — the packaging is biodegradable and recyclable.

I threw a Toliet Bomb in, let the Toliet Bomb fizz away, and gave the water a swish. Not much scrubbing was needed — the Toliet Bomb killed the film and bacterial build-up. Also, it has helped keep the film build-up away — not needing to clean every two days now.

Lastly, I tried the Scrubbing Paste on multiple surfaces in my house; the kitchen sink, bathroom sink, under the toilet lids, and the shower. I do an evening wipe-through of all the surfaces and a rinse of the sinks in the house. But, every week the house still needs a nice scrub down, especially our shower. Just like the toilet we have a film build-up in our shower, especially our shower head. On top of that — my seven-year-old is a big fan of painting, which causes my shower to turn nice colors. The scrubbing paste worked wonders on the film build-up, water stains, bath bomb residue, toothpaste left behind, and paint!

When cleaning the sinks I added scrubbing paste to a Swedish dishcloth, and it cleaned up all the left behind residue. For the shower — I added the scrubbing paste to a biodegradable sponge to clean the surface and then an old toothbrush to clean crevices.

I will have to say that I was very impressed with both the Toliet Bombs and Scrubbing Paste. The surfaces/spaces were left clean and had a natural smell. Also, the price tag is much more reasonable than a green cleaning subscription service or ordering offline.
